Hello everybody. I've been meaning to do a grow log for a long while now just so I can more easily keep a photo and time record. What better place than the Growery.

I'm planning on doing a Screen of Green this go around to optimize my growing space. I grow in my spare bathroom so I have easy water access, I will also have the plants sitting on a grate shelf on top of the bathtub for easy cleanup and drainage. Not to mention the fiberglass in the shower provides great light reflection!

Speaking of light, for this stage I'm using a single 400w MH with a running time of 24hrs. When I switch to flowering I will be using two 400w HPS.

I'm also using Roots Organic soil, for those who are unfamiliar with it the ingredient list is as follows...
  Coco fiber
  Peat moss
  Perlite
  Pumice
  Compost
  Mulch
  Worm castings
  Bat guano
  Kelp meal
  Fish bone meal
  Soybean meal
  Prilled rock phosphate
  Feather meal
  Greensand
  Leonardite
  Alfalfa Meal
  Oyster shell flower
  Glacial rock dust

May 2nd - 3 weeks 2 days

Transplanted today, but 3 days ago a few problems started to appear on 4 of the 6 plants when the soil got a little on the dry side when I was out of the house for 2 days. I've been watering with pH balanced water, but tested the runoff for the first time when I started noticing problems and it is showing a pH of 8+. Even with watering 5 pH the runoff is still easily 8 or above (the soil wasn't very saturated when doing the 5pH runoff test). I never saw problems like this using the same exact routine on clones. (maybe it was that short stint of dryness?)

On with the pics...

First, here is a pic of the group. The Purple Indica is on the top left.

Here is a pic of whatever problem the P.I. is having, has necrotic spots on a few of the lower fan leafs.


Now here is some pics of the problems that 3 out of the 5 g-13xNL are having.


These pictures are pretty consistent showing about the same problem throughout the 3 plants. But, one of the three also has one fan leaf looking like this:



From doing some reading on this forum, I'd say it almost looks like an MG def. but I can't be totally sure because the spotting and browning looks pretty inconsistent with the pics of MG def. I've seen around.

Question is, is this a pH problem, or is it a nutrient def. problem? I'll let you experts help me out before my assumptions kill my seed babies!

Quote:

and0rr said:
I'm going to light proof my door jam tonight then switch to 18/6 per DieselB's recommendation tomorrow. We'll see how long it takes them to show sex. Hopefully soon so I can start with the LST.




Keep in mind that switching from 24/0 -> 18/6 -> 12/12 is going to stress your plants in a way that 24/0 -> 12/12 will not. I would either LST them all now anyways and start flowering or flower clones to determine sex and keep pre-vegging. Just my two cents.
